To help seniors avoid this coverage gap, AARP is launching a new online resource called the AARP Doughnut Hole Calculator.
Available at www.aarp.org/doughnuthole, the resource guides visitors through their prescription drug options using local information about their plans and prescriptions to determine if or when they will fall into the coverage gap.
In about 15 minutes, visitors can view a graph of their out-of-pocket spending by month, look up lower-cost drugs for their conditions, create a personal medication record and print personal letters to their doctors to help start a conversation about safely switching prescriptions.
"Seventeen percent of New Hampshire residents in Medicare fall into the gap each year, and many more nervously wonder if they might fall in," said Kelly Clark, AARP New Hampshire state director. "For the first time, people in Medicare have a simple way to learn if they'll fall into the doughnut hole and find ways to avoid it by switching to safe, less expensive medications."
The calculator is powered by DestinationRx as part of a special arrangement between AARP and Medicare. The data are the same used by the Medicare Prescription Drug Plan Finder, giving users the most accurate and up-to-date drug pricing information available, the AARP said.
